Digital Desk: Nagaland Police, early in a dramatic late-night operation, arrested a man who was posing as a Sub-Inspector of Assam Police at Watiyongpang check gate in Mokokchung district. The individual is identified as Dipankar Gogoi, who hails from Hatimuria village in Amguri, Sivasagar district, Assam. He was caught smuggling a large quantity of liquor while wearing a police uniform and driving a vehicle and driving a vehicle falsely marked as a police car.
According to a statement issued by the Additional Superintendent of Police & PRO, Mokokchung, the incident took place at approximately 12.30 AM on 15th July. Dipankar was driving a white Indica (registration number AS 03 H 9220) with the inscription of POLICE written prominently on the windscreen. Upon inspection, the police discovered a significant quantity of Indian Made Foreign Liquor (IMFL) concealed inside the car.
The seized items include:
- 2 cartons of MC Rum (750ml)
- 12 cartons of MC Rum (180ml)
- 1 carton of AC Black Whisky (180ml)
- 4 cartons of Kingfisher beer
Currently, Dipankar Gogoi works as a driver at the Assam Fire and Emergency Services headquarters in Panbazar, Guwahati. Despite his real job, he was dressed in a police uniform at the time of the arrest and falsely claimed to be an Inspector with the Assam Police.
The Mokokchung Police have registered a regular case under relevant sections of the Indian Penal Code (IPC), the Motor Vehicles Act, and the Nagaland Liquor Total Prohibition (NLTP) Act. The case is being investigated, and authorities are investigating the scope of the impersonation and liquor smuggling operation.
